Derby Academy (School of Dance) - History

History

Derby Academy's founder and principal, Eve Leveaux, trained at Ballet Rambert in Paris, and was taught by Dame Marie Rambert before returning to England to start a family.

Derby Academy (School of Dance) is located in a former textile mill until it was lovingly restored and renovated in 1978.
